Abstract

This book constitutes the refereed post-conference proceedings of the 5th and 6th International Workshops on Computational Forensics, IWCF 2012 and IWCF 2014, held in Tsukuba, Japan, in November 2010 and August 2014. The 16 revised full papers and 1 short paper were carefully selected from 34 submissions during a thorough review process. The papers are divided into three broad areas namely biometrics; document image inspection; and applications.

Abstract

This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-workshop proceedings of the 5th International Workshop on Camera-Based Document Analysis and Recognition, CBDAR 2013, held in Washington, DC, USA, in August 2013. The 14 revised full papers presented were carefully selected during two rounds of reviewing and improvement from numerous original submissions. Intended to give a snapshot of the state-of-the-art research in the field of camera based document analysis and recognition, the papers are organized in topical sections on text detection and recognition in scene images, and camera-based systems.

Abstract

This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-workshop-proceedings of the 4th International Workshop on Camera-Based Document Analysis and Recognition, CBDAR 2011, held in Beijing, China, in September 2011. The 13 revised full papers presented were carefully selected during a second round of reviewing and improvement from numerous original submissions. Intended to give a snapshot of the state-of-the-art research in the field of camera based document analysis and recognition, the papers are organized in topical sections on text detection and recognition in scene images, camera-based systems, and datasets and evaluation.
